Updated World Cup Bracket 2026 After France vs. Morocco Quarterfinal Results

France advances to the 2026 World Cup semi-finals following a victory over Morocco, while status reports on Kylian Mbappé remain a primary focus.

The brief

The victory follows the finalization of the tournament bracket for the concluding stages of the competition. Coverage from The Guardian, The New York Times, Yahoo Sports, ESPN, and Bleacher Report centers on the match outcome and the physical condition of Kylian Mbappé.

While outlets report an injury scare involving an ankle, subsequent statements from Mbappé indicate he feels fine. Future reports will track the status of the updated bracket as the tournament progresses toward the final matches.

Coverage does not yet specify the upcoming opponent for the French squad.
